A lively and very smart bookBy Susan AlexanderIn My Fair Ladies. art-historian/painter/ professor Julie Wosk has given us a brilliant history of artificial (read "man-made") women. along with her insightful commentary into this fascinating phenomenon.Beginning with a lively discussion of the Pygmalion myth first created in ancient Greece. a myth that has evolved over the centuries into many different versions. including the play by George Bernard Shaw and musical theaters My Fair Lady. Wosks book moves swiftly through literature. movies. TV. art. robotics. and photography.Richly illustrated with photographs. art. and scenes from movies and television. the book includes Wosks clever commentary on the apparently unending male desire to create artificial--even robotic--women.My Fair Ladies presents an extraordinary cavalcade of "artificial evesrdquo; in this lively and very smart book.1 of 2 people found the following review helpful.
